Patty Smyth fascinates me as a product of a vanished era. Fronting Scandal and later going solo, she built her name on a voice and an image beamed through MTV at a time when an artist had nothing but talent and nerve to win an audience. There were no algorithms to chase, no follower counts to game, just that husky, commanding delivery cutting through cable static. I respect singers who made it on raw sound alone, and she clearly did. A 1957 New Yorker with grit, she represents the kind of authentic new wave craft I keep rooting for.
